    If you are ready to make peace with those who have hurt or betrayed you, there can be no finer road map than this thoroughly practical book. Lewis Smedes brings true forgiveness, "Gods own gift," within the capacity of every wounded person, even in circumstances when only hate seems possible. With inspiring words, he leads you through the three stages of forgiveness and helps you understand:


    Why we forgive (often the person who benefits most is the forgiver)
    What we do when we forgive (perhaps not what we expect)
    Whom we forgive (only those who directly wrong us)
    How we forgive (we start by owning our pain)  


    Using many dramatic examples drawn from life, this wise author illuminates, step by step, the healing path to peace and freedom.
